Book Review: America, U.S.A. by Eddie S. Glaude Jr.
Author: Eddie S. Glaude Jr.
Title: America, U.S.A.: How Race Shadows the Nation’s Anniversaries
Narrator: Eddie S. Glaude Jr.
Publication Info: Books on Tape, 2026
Summary/Review:The author explores this history of the United States by focusing on how the nation celebrates its anniversaries. The picture emerges is a consistent effort to define the United States as a nation of, by, and for white people, erasing Black people from the narrative.
Glaude visits the centennial of 1876, held a decade after the war to end slavery when white people North and South had grown “fatigued” with Reconstruction. Frederick Douglass was barred from taking his spot on the grandstand until a white man vouched for him. The compromise that ended Reconstruction and enabled Jim Crow segregation would be sealed the following year.
In 1926, the revived Ku Klux Klan were at the height of their political influence, including at the Sesqui-Centennial Exposition in Philadelphia. Recent quota-based immigration restrictions emphasized the desire to keep the USA for whites only. And in 1976, the Bicentennial celebrations were hijacked to promote American unity after the the turmoil of the Civil Rights movement, anti-war protests, and the Watergate scandal troubled the idea of a national consensus. At this time, Black people were mentioned in the historical narrative, but only in that their freedom from slavery and segregation came through the promise of the Declaration of Independence, not their own efforts.
Which brings us to today. Glaude published this book before the America 250 debacle in Washington, but recently enough to have analyzed the plans for the event. A recurring theme throughout this book is the idea of “Storybook America,” a narrative of freedom derived from the Founders, continuous progress, and exceptionalism that ignores any of the inconvenient truths of inequality, violence, and slavery. With the Trump regime attempting to enforce a celebratory historical account of the United States in National Parks, museums, and schools we’re facing the danger of “Storybook America” becoming our only curriculum. Glaude draws on the inspiration of and builds on the work of writers such as W.E.B. Du Bois and James Baldwin, and his work is a fitting addition to the body of cultural critique of race in America.

Privilege and luck play a huge role in whether you survive our healthcare system.
Bias, racism and misogyny are rampant and frequently cost people their lives.
A surgical complication almost killed me when I was 24.
Luck, privilege and a 22 year old boy saved my life.
No one’s survival should be based on luck or how much privilege they have.
People should have a reasonable expectation of safety in a hospital.
They should be treated the same regardless of their skin colour, marital status, sexual orientation or insurance status.
Sadly that’s not how things work.
I had a hysterectomy when I was 24. Doctors expected me to “sail through” recovery because I was young and fit.
Unfortunately they were wrong. My body wasn’t recovering, it was decompensating.
I had many abdominal surgeries before the hysterectomy. I knew the difference between normal post op pain and something being “wrong”.
After surgery I felt like I was dying.
My pain worsened every day.
I became more fatigued. I couldn’t eat or sleep.
But no one believed me.
The surgeon discharged me.
I returned to the ER and told them something was wrong.
They dismissed me and sent me home.
I went back multiple times and each time was treated like a nuisance.
I was gaslit and told my pain was “normal”.
No one even ran basic tests.
Even people in my life started to doubt me.
Told me I should just rest and stop bothering the folks at the ER.
I KNEW something was wrong but I was rapidly losing the ability to self advocate as I became too weak to speak or even sit up.
My 22 year old boyfriend came to check on me and instantly realized things were dire.
He called a coworker to take us back to the hospital.
He caused a scene to ensure a doctor saw me and I wasn’t sent home again.
They threatened to call the police but he refused to back down.
He was right.
I had a massive internal bleed and an infected abscess.
I was immediately evacuated to a larger hospital for emergency surgery and only given a 50/50 chance of survival.
I spent nearly a month in the hospital recovering.
I didn’t even want to go back to the ER that day.
I was thoroughly beaten down.
Being dismissed and mistreated so many times left me feeling hopeless and like I would rather die in my own bed than be disrespected in the hospital AGAIN.
No one should face these types of decisions.
No one should have to fight that hard for care.
Had my boyfriend not believed me, I would have died.
Had he told me to stop bothering ER staff, I would have died.
Had he not come to check on me that night, I would have died.
He wasn’t prepared to handle such an intense life or death situation… but he stepped up because no one else did.
He saw the danger and fought like hell to protect me.
That’s privilege.
The fact that he wasn’t arrested? Privilege and luck.
I’m grateful to him for being willing to risk his own safety to ensure I got the care I needed, but I hate that it took a man causing a scene to get the healthcare system to pay attention.
I hate that others have died simply because they didn’t have someone to fight for them.
We must do better.
We must call out the bias in medicine and ensure everyone is equally protected.
We must establish networks of community care so that no one ever has to face the ER alone.
We must tell our stories so people know they aren’t alone.
We must amplify the stories of those without platforms so their voices are heard too.
If you’ve been mistreated, know that it’s not your fault.
The system needs to change, and we will keep fighting until it does.

…the “Spirit of ’76 at Freedom Plaza” exhibition centers on a large equestrian statue of Caesar Rodney, a Founding Father from Delaware & an enslaver….
…The installation gives the controversial Rodney statue, which was taken down from its original site in Wilmington, DE, during the 2020 #BlackLivesMatter protests, a prominent new home, perhaps temporary, in the symbolic center of the nation’s capital.

#Astralia: "The rate of First Nations prisoners jumped to more than 2,500 per 100,000 adults in 2025 and up from more than 2,300 a year earlier and more than 550 in 2019.
… First Nations youths remain heavily over-represented in detention, with 25.7 children aged 10–17 per 10,000 in custody on an average day in 2024-25 and ‘‘no change from the baseline’’ towards the target of a 30 per cent cut by 2031."
